New England Apple Crisp Pie

Here's how you make New England Apple Crisp Pie
Pause Continue Reading
  • Servings: 8
  • Prep: 15m
  • Cook: 45m
  • The following recipe serves 8 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 1 (9-inch) pie pastry
  • 4 to 5 peeled and cored (1 1/4 to 1 1/2 pounds) apples (thinly sliced)
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 to 3 t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 3/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 3 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up margarine, softened

How to Make

  • Step 1: Toss apples with the 2-3 tablespoons sugar. Place into pie

  • Step 2: Shell, rounding up in the center.

  • Step 3: Combine remaining ingredients in bowl, mixing until mixture resembles moist crumbs. Sprinkle over top of apples.

  • Step 4: Bake 15 minutes at 425 degrees.

  • Step 5: Reduce heat to 350 degrees, for 30 minutes more, until crunchy and brown.
